50375 (Разработка интеллектуального агента глоссария с набором терминов по тематическим вопросам), страница 4
Описание файла
Документ из архива "Разработка интеллектуального агента глоссария с набором терминов по тематическим вопросам", который расположен в категории "". Всё это находится в предмете "информатика" из 1 семестр, которые можно найти в файловом архиве . Не смотря на прямую связь этого архива с , его также можно найти и в других разделах. Архив можно найти в разделе "курсовые/домашние работы", в предмете "информатика, программирование" в общих файлах.
Онлайн просмотр документа "50375"
Текст 4 страницы из документа "50375"
Заметим, что по мере работы пользователя мультиагентная система имеет возможность получать все больше данных о его предпочтениях как явно (анкетирование, обработка пользовательских запросов), так и неявно (например, анализируя статистику посещения различных разделов). На базе этой информации можно строить эвристические классификации пользователей и предположения о «следующих шагах» пользователя, соответствующим образом подстраивать средства навигации, формировать образовательные сценарии (например, в зависимости от уровня подготовки пользователя или времени, которым он располагает).
Список терминов агента глоссария представляет собой небольшое количество ссылок на лекции, лабораторные работы, контрольные вопросы и другие знания, содержащиеся в системе, которые желательно посетить пользователю в данный момент.
Любое нажатие пользователя на гиперактивную ссылку активизирует агента и в последствии серию переговоров между агентами. На первом этапе переговоры осуществляются между агентами знаний и агентом пользователя, выявляя, таким образом, на этом шаге элементы знаний нашей системы, которые необходимы в данный момент пользователю.
В данной курсовой работе были использованные принципы мультиагентной системы. На основе интеллектуальных агентов была решена оптимизационная задача и разработана оптимальное предложение по использованию средств дистанционного обучения в сети Интернет.
-
Для выполнения задач, поставленных в курсовой работе:
-
проанализированы методы оптимизации структур вычислительных систем;
-
исследованы основные принципы и концепции интеллектуальных агентов;
-
применено средство для поиска информации с помощью интеллектуальных агентов в мультиагентной системе для оптимизации работы дистанционного обучения;
-
создан программный модуль, который реализует роботу интеллектуального агента глоссария соответственно заданным характеристикам, целям, планам и фактам системы для дистанционного обучения.
-
Основными функциями разработанного программного модуля есть поиск оптимального варианта дополнительной информации, которая в данный момент наиболее подходит для пользователя.
В заключение отметим, что применяемая технология интеллектуальных агентов для разработки системы дистанционного обучения через Интернет, позволит не только упростить и качественно улучшить процесс получения человеком знаний и информации в мире. Также даст возможность персональному агенту пользователя решать автономно задачи, поставленные перед ним, приобретать и систематизировать знания, что позволит вывести подобные системы на качественно другой уровень, сделав агентов незаменимыми помощниками в процессе обучения.
ПЕРЕЧЕНЬ ССЫЛОК
-
Основы технологий ДО http://www.websoft.ru/db/wb/42D07B203E7BFAB1C3256 C24004EE7FF/doc.html
-
Интернет технологии в образовании - дистанционное обучение http://www.curator.ru.htm
-
Multiagent Systems. A Modern Approach to Distributed Modern Approach to Artificial Intelligence. Edited by Gerhard Weiss. The MIT Press. Cambridge, Massachusetts. London, England. 1999 Massachusetts Institute of Technology.
-
Мультиагентные системы http://teormin.ifmo.ru/education/intro/multiagent-systems.html
-
Самоорганизация и эволюция в открытых мультиагентных системах для холонических предприятий http://eup.ru/pages/R06/Biblio/2002-08-05/F182.htm
-
Proceedings of the International Conference for Internet Technology and Secured Transactions (ICITST-2006). Editors Charles A. Shoniregun, Alex Logvynovskiy. Published by the e-Centre for Infonomics, UK.
-
Jadex Tool Guide. A. Pokahr, L. Braubach, R. Leppin, and A. Walczak. Distributed Systems Group. University of Hamburg, Germany. 2005. http://vsis-www.informatik.uni-hamburg.de
-
Jadex User Guide. A. Pokahr, L. Braubach, and A. Walczak. . Distributed Systems Group. University of Hamburg, Germany. 2005. http://vsis-www.informatik.uni-hamburg.de
-
System Architecture with XML. Berthold Daum Udo Merten. Morgan Kaufmann Publishers. San Francisco, USA.. 2003 by Elsevier Science http://www.mkp.com/
-
Introduction to DTD http://www.w3schools.com/dtd/dtd_intro.asp
-
Модели обучения автоматизированных обучающих систем http://systech.miem.edu.ru/2004/n2/Cibulskiy.htm
-
Jadex Tutorial. L. Braubach, A. Pokahr, and A. Walczak. Distributed Systems Group. University of Hamburg, Germany. 2005 http://vsis-www.informatik.uni-hamburg.de
-
NIST (Nationals Institute of Standards and Technology) http://www.nist.gov/
-
Проблемы реализации мультиагентных систем дистанционного обучения в сети Интернет http://www.vedu.ru/info/Announce/PHT2000/thesis.asp?str=4_04
-
Использование мультиагентного онтологического подхода к созданию распределенных систем дистанционного обучения http://ifets.ieee.org/russian/depository/ v7_i2/pdf/3.pdf
-
Система автоматизированного сетевого и дистанционного обучения с мультиагентной архитектурой http://www.ito.su/main.php?pid=26&fid=4317&PHPSESSID= d12d7b5d09fc001d24e3d7212d732be2
-
ДСТУ 3008-95 Документация. Отчеты в сфере науки и техники. Структура и правила оформления, Госстандарт Украины, 1995.
-
FIPA Agent Management Specification. 1996-2002 Foundation for Intelligent Physical Agents http://www.fipa.org/
Приложение А
Список терминов в формате XML
GlossaryTerm.xml
dictionary
1
An abstract data type storing items, or values. A value is accessed by an associated key. Basic operations are new, insert, find and delete.
abstract data type
key
heap
1
A complete tree where every node has a key more extreme (greater or less) than or equal to the key of its parent. Usually understood to be a binary heap.
complete tree
key
node
parent
binary heap
linked list
1
A list implemented by each item having a link to the next item.
list
link
queue
1
A collection of items in which only the earliest added item may be accessed. Basic operations are add (to the tail) or enqueue and delete (from the head) or dequeue. Delete returns the item removed. Also known as "first-in, first-out" or FIFO.
head
tail
stack
1
A collection of items in which only the most recently added item may be removed. The latest added item is at the top. Basic operations are push and pop. Often top and isEmpty are available, too. Also known as "last-in, first-out" or LIFO.
tree
2
A data structure accessed beginning at the root node. Each node is either a leaf or an internal node. An internal node has one or more child nodes and is called the parent of its child nodes. All children of the same node are siblings. Contrary to a physical tree, the root is usually depicted at the top of the structure, and the leaves are depicted at the bottom.
A connected, undirected, acyclic graph. It is rooted and ordered unless otherwise specified.
node
tree
parent
root
leaf
internal node
child
siblings
connected
undirected
acyclic graph
rooted
ordered
array
1
A set of items which are randomly accessible by numeric index.
array index
1
The location of an item in an array.
array
child
1
A node of a tree referred to by a parent node. See the figure at tree. Every node, except the root, is the child of some parent.
node
tree
parent
root
circular list
1
A variant of a linked list in which the nominal tail is linked to the head. The entire list may be accessed starting at any item and following links until one comes to the starting item again.
linked list
link
tail
complete tree
1
A tree in which all leaf nodes are at some depth n or n-1, and all leaves at depth n are toward the left.
tree
depth
leaf
connected graph
1
An undirected graph that has a path between every pair of vertices.
depth
1
Of a node, the distance from the node to the root of the tree.
node
tree
root
doubly linked list
1
A variant of a linked list in which each item has a link to the previous item as well as the next. This allows easily accessing list items backward as well as forward and deleting any item in constant time.
linked list
link
dynamic array
1
An array whose size may change over time. Items are not only added or removed, but memory used changes, too.
array
height
1
The maximum distance of any leaf from the root of a tree. If a tree has only one node (the root), the height is zero.
leaf
tree
root
internal node
1
A node of a tree that has one or more child nodes, equivalently, one that is not a leaf.
leaf
tree
node
child
leaf
1
A node in a tree without any children. See the figure at tree.
leaf
tree
node
children
linear search
1
Search an array or list by checking items one at a time.
list
array
link
1
A reference, pointer, or access handle to another part of the data structure. Often, a memory address.
list
array
list
1
A collection of items accessible one after another beginning at the head and ending at the tail.
head
tail
matrix
1
A two-dimensional array. By convention, the first index is the row, and the second index is the column.
node
2
A unit of reference in a data structure. Also called a vertex in graphs and trees.
A collection of information which must be kept at a single memory location.
graphs
trees
vertex
order
4
The height of a tree.
The number of children of the root of a binomial tree.
The maximum number of children of nodes in a B-tree.
The number of data streams, usually denoted, in a multiway merge.
height
tree
children
root
node
ordered linked list
1
A linked list whose items are kept in some order.
linked list
ordered tree
1
A tree where the children of every node are ordered, that is, there is a first child, second child, third child, etc.
tree
children
node
parent
1
Of a node: the tree node conceptually above or closer to the root than the node and which has a link to the node. See the figure at tree.
tree
link
root
node
root
1
The distinguished initial or fundamental item of a tree. The only item which has no parent. See the figure at tree.
tree
parent
search
1
To look for a value or item in a data structure. There are dozens of algorithms, data structures, and approaches.
self-organizing list
1
A list that reorders the elements based on some self-organizing heuristic to improve average access time.
list
self-organizing heuristic
sibling
1
A node in a tree that has the same parent as another node is its sibling.
tree
parent
node
sorted array
1
An array whose items are kept sorted, often so searching is faster.
array
sorted list
1
A list whose items are kept sorted.
list
square matrix
1
A n*n matrix, i.e., one whose size is the same in both dimensions.
matrix
tail
2
The last item of a list.
All but the first item of a list; the list following the head.
list
Приложение В
Описание тегов XML документа в формате DTD
GlossaryTerm.dtd
title CDATA #REQUIRED
orderDate CDATA "">
value CDATA #REQUIRED>
ref CDATA #REQUIRDE>
count CDATA #REQUIRDE>
Размещено на Allbest.ru